Slow Sundays – a new way to celebrate Roberts Creek! From June to September, Slow Sundays will be all-day happenings in the little park space behind Roberts Creek Library. The day starts with Board Silly, a drop-in chance to play Scrabble and other games on tables under the trees. The Heart Market, featuring local crafts and food, runs from 11 a.m. to 2 p.m. After that, enjoy live music concerts on the Slowcalo Stage from 2:30 to 4 p.m., featuring many fabulous Coast musicians. Also planned are a potluck picnic and/or activities under the maple tree by the post office, with buskers, Qigong, family art activities and more. Organizers need your support. If you are interested, attend a meeting this Friday, May 13 at the Gumboot Café at 7 p.m. You can also contact Graham Walker at 604-886-2417 or Lesley and Rob at the Eco-Freako store in the Creek. On Thursday, May 19, at the Roberts Creek Hall attend Community Dialogue, hosted by SCRD staff and Roberts Creek director Mark Lebbell. Doors open at 6:45 p.m. for a 7 to 8:30 p.m. session. Come out and bring SCRD senior staff your questions, concerns and ideas around SCRD initiatives, functions and programs. This a new more informal approach to public participation; come to hear and be heard. Find more information at robertscreekmark.com/newsblog or SCRD.ca

Creative in the Creek is on Thursday, May 19, hosted by David Roche. Doors open at 7 p.m.; show time is 7:30 to 9:30 p.m. at the Gumboot Café. Admission is by donation at the door. All proceeds will benefit the Syrian Refugee Sponsorship established by the Christian Life Assembly congregation. Featured will be Pastor Jaz Ghag, David Yates on didgeridoo, Ada Smith of the Fruit Tree Project, Michael Klein reading choice stories from his upcoming book and more.
